Carrier Screening Insights From a Maternal-Fetal Medicine Practice

Carrier screening is used to determine reproductive risk for autosomal recessive or X-linked conditions, and its clinical implementation varies widely. We evaluated recurring clinical patterns observed at an independent, university-affiliated, high-volume maternal-fetal medicine center in Los Angeles receiving referrals from diverse practice settings. In our view, carrier screening is far too frequently performed later than ideal, which narrows timelines for partner testing, prenatal diagnosis, and decision making and increases patient distress. Carrier screening practices differ by referring clinician, resulting in inequities in detecting genetic risk. Within a single couple, partners are often screened on discordant panels (and sometimes sequentially, maternal-first), which delays risk clarification and increases the chance of misinterpretation. Based on these observations, we believe prepregnancy carrier screening should be prioritized; otherwise, carrier screening should be performed as early as possible in pregnancy with concurrent partner testing. We also believe patients should receive counseling on the benefits and limitations of all available screening options to preserve patient autonomy.
